
GP Win and Red Plate for Courtney Duncan in Spain
Big Van World MTX Kawasaki's Courtney Duncan took over the series lead in the FIM World WMX Women’s Motocross Championship with victory for the third consecutive year in Arroyomolinos, Spain.
The New Zealander was once again dominant on her KX™250 as she raced to her first double-moto victory of the season and her twenty-first career GP victory to place her in a tie for first in the all-time series records. She was closed down by another rider out of the gate but, secure in the knowledge that her strength, endurance and speed would serve her well, she didn't panic. Quickly to fifth in sticky conditions with deep ruts building in many turns due to the track-watering necessary to combat the intense heat, she chose her lines cleverly to avoid coming together with her rivals, picking them off one-by-one to move to the front on the fourth of 11 laps, eventually cruising home to victory by seven seconds. The Kiwi girl now takes a 10-point lead to the next round of the series at Villars-sous-Ecot, France in two weeks' time while Kawasaki also extended the lead in the FIM Manufacturers' Championship to sixteen points courtesy of Duncan's double-moto victory.

Courtney Duncan
"Obviously I'm really stoked. Two wins and the red plate; I couldn't hope for a whole lot more. I felt my start wasn't all that good, especially round the first corner, but I made a few positions through the next two turns and rode patiently. We didn't really have a warm-up this morning and the track was completely different to yesterday so I wanted to find my lines before I worked my way to the front. It's nice to have the series lead but there's a lot of racing still to be done; roll on to France in two weeks' time and hopefully we can keep the momentum rolling."
Lotte van Drunen
“Yesterday was tough but I told myself last night I just needed to have fun today and see how it goes. I woke up this morning with a good feeling; I saw on the sighting lap that the track was rough with many lines and I was able to go around everyone for second at turn two. I got pushed back to sixth at one point but then I had a good battle with the girls in front of me, switching places several times to finish fifth. My riding was good and I rode the fastest lap of the race so that gives me confidence for the next round in France; I've never been to Villars but I'm sure I can do good there too.”
